YouTube Music is YouTube’s official streaming platform, available in 94 territories. Any recordings you upload to AWAL will be delivered to YouTube Music automatically, so they’re available to stream on the YouTube Music app. The platform has both a Free tier and a Premium tier:
- Free: The YouTube Music free tier allows users to access and stream the YouTube Music catalog with ads placed in between tracks.
- Music Premium: YouTube Music offers an ad-free tier that requires a paid subscription. The subscription allows listeners to access YouTube Music and YouTube content ad-free. This tier also allows offline & background listening modes.
In addition to your tracks going live on YouTube Music, our deliveries will also generate an “Art Track” (packshot video) that appears on a Topic Channel created for your artist on YouTube. These videos cannot be taken down and the image displayed will always be the cover artwork you’ve uploaded with your release. You can read more about Art Tracks here.
YouTube Music streams will be accounted to you in your monthly statements.
Note: YouTube Music operates independently from Content ID
